Overview

GD Goenka Public School is a prominent chain of private educational institutions in India, renowned for its modern approach to learning and comprehensive academic programs. Established in 1994 by the GD Goenka Group, the school has grown from a single campus in New Delhi to a nationwide network with international presence. The institution emphasizes holistic development, combining rigorous academics with extracurricular activities to prepare students for global challenges. Its founding vision was to create an educational environment that fosters innovation, creativity, and ethical leadership.

The school's main campus is located in Vasant Kunj, New Delhi, specifically at Sector 22, Pocket B-6, which serves as the flagship location and administrative hub. Over the years, GD Goenka has expanded to include more than 50 campuses across India, including cities like Mumbai, Lucknow, and Jaipur, as well as international branches in countries such as the United Arab Emirates and Singapore. This growth reflects its commitment to providing quality education accessible to diverse communities. The school is affiliated with the Central Board of Secondary Education (CBSE), ensuring standardized curriculum and recognition across India.
